read the following text from crashing cassini: a titanic journey to saturn by ringo bella.
the cassini mission was the most successful international space mission. for thirteen years, cassini sent images and data about saturn to scientists on earth. without cassini, the faraway planet saturn would likely still be a complete mystery today.
a student used information from the above text to write a report about the planet saturn. select the sentence in the students report that plagiarizes the above text.
saturn is the sixth planet from the sun in our solar system. it has many moons, including its largest, titan, which many scientists believe to be quite earth - like. the 1997 - 2017 cassini space mission transmitted pictures and information about saturn and its moons back to earth. without cassini, the faraway planet saturn would likely still be a complete mystery today.
Plagiarism involves using someone else's words or ideas without proper citation. The sentence "Without Cassini, the faraway planet Saturn would likely still be a complete mystery today." in the student's report is directly copied from the original text without citation.
